Burnout Prevention – Skill #3: Find engaging work.

Engaging work will absorb, interest, and involve you. Very high levels of engagement are known as a state called “flow”, in which you are so completely absorbed in an activity that you lose all sense of time.
Research shows that choosing tasks, negotiating different job content, and assigning meaning to various components of your job is predictive of work engagement.

3 Tips to Increase Work Engagement
1. Enhance the job you have. How can you shape the activities you perform and the interactions you have at work to express your values, strengths, and passions more fully? Can you take on additional tasks more closely related to your goals?

2. Grow your relationships at work. Think about how you are connecting and interacting with your colleagues and stakeholders. How could you communicate more meaningfully with the people around you?

3. Eat the frog! Conquer your hardest, most important task first thing in the morning. Organise your work to match your energy levels.
